    Subject[PATCH 2/2] arm64: Define PAGE_OFFSET using GENMASK_ULL
    Date
    As is the definition causes an integer overflow, which is expected,
    however clang raises the following warning:

    arch/arm64/kernel/head.S:47:8: warning:
    integer overflow in preprocessor expression
    #elif (PAGE_OFFSET & 0x1fffff) != 0
    ^~~~~~~~~~~
    arch/arm64/include/asm/memory.h:52:46: note:
    expanded from macro 'PAGE_OFFSET'
    #define PAGE_OFFSET (UL(0xffffffffffffffff) << (VA_BITS - 1))
    ~~~~~~~~~~~~~~~~~~ ^ ~~~~~~~~~~~~~

    Use GENMASK_ULL() instead of shifting explicitly, the macro takes care
    of avoiding the overflow.

    Reported-by: Nick Desaulniers <ndesaulniers@google.com>
    Signed-off-by: Matthias Kaehlcke <mka@chromium.org>
    ---
    arch/arm64/include/asm/memory.h | 2 +-
    1 file changed, 1 insertion(+), 1 deletion(-)

    diff --git a/arch/arm64/include/asm/memory.h b/arch/arm64/include/asm/memory.h
    index 32f82723338a..732d4eed8edd 100644
    --- a/arch/arm64/include/asm/memory.h
    +++ b/arch/arm64/include/asm/memory.h
    @@ -65,7 +65,7 @@
    */
    #define VA_BITS (CONFIG_ARM64_VA_BITS)
    #define VA_START (UL(0xffffffffffffffff) << VA_BITS)
    -#define PAGE_OFFSET (UL(0xffffffffffffffff) << (VA_BITS - 1))
    +#define PAGE_OFFSET GENMASK_ULL(BITS_PER_LONG_LONG - 1, VA_BITS - 1)
    #define KIMAGE_VADDR (MODULES_END)
    #define MODULES_END (MODULES_VADDR + MODULES_VSIZE)
    #define MODULES_VADDR (VA_START + KASAN_SHADOW_SIZE)
